Faroese[edit]

Etymology[edit]

From apa (mokey) +‎ pokur (smallpox, pox)

Noun[edit]

apupokur f pl (plurale tantum, genitive plural apupoka)

  1. (virology) mpox, monkeypox
    Synonym: apukoppar
    • 2022 May 23, Alda Nielsdóttir, “Apupokur komnar til Danmarkar [Monkeypox has arrived in Denmark]”, in dagur.fo[1]:
      Í dag upplýsir danska heilsumálaráðið, at fyrsit tilburðurin av apupokum er staðfestur í Danmark.
      Today, the Danish Ministry of Health informs that the first case of monkeypox has been confirmed in Denmark.
